Defining the Role of a Mass Tort Lawyer Does

A mass tort lawyer is a legal professional who represents injured victims whose damages were connected to a shared wrongdoer — typically a product manufacturer. Unlike a class action, where every claimant receive the same judgment, mass tort claims let every plaintiff to seek individualized compensation based on personal losses they suffered. This distinction is critically important because individual plaintiffs suffer identically from an environmental hazard.

Mechanically, mass tort litigation often starts when legal teams notice a trend of injuries connected to a identifiable source. Your mass tort lawyer will build a record including diagnostic reports, expert testimony, and internal company documents to establish liability. Mass tort claims are commonly grouped into MDL proceedings under a framework referred to as Multidistrict Litigation, or MDL, which speeds up pre-trial proceedings.

The investigation phase requires a firm grasp of both medical research and complex procedural rules. The Mass Tort Lawyer Process Step by Step

  1. The Introductory Case Review — Your journey begins with a no-cost, no-obligation consultation where a mass tort lawyer examines what happened to you. That first conversation allows us to assess whether your health problems could stem from a documented dangerous drug.
  2. Collecting the Key Records — When you move forward, your mass tort lawyer gets to work collecting medical records, prescription histories, and employment records that define the full extent of your harm and damages.
  3. Establishing Corporate Fault — H&P Accident & Injury Lawyers enlists independent professionals in pharmacology, science, and product design to link your diagnosed conditions directly to the company's conduct.
  4. Submitting Your Claim — The formal complaint is submitted with the proper jurisdiction and, if warranted, consolidated within an existing federal coordination program. This stage ensures your case benefits from coordinated research already developed by other victims.
  5. Discovery and Deposition Phase — At this stage, your mass tort lawyer demands internal corporate documents that show when warnings were suppressed and whether they acted responsibly. Sworn statements from key employees often produce important revelations that support your case.
  6. Settlement Negotiation or Trial Preparation — A large percentage of mass tort cases conclude with a negotiated agreement, but our team prepares every case as though a jury will decide it. Mass Tort Lawyer FAQ

What is the usual timeline for a mass tort lawsuit?

Mass tort cases generally take longer than standard personal injury lawsuits. Depending on the stage of the coordinating litigation, resolution may come anywhere from a couple of years to a decade after your claim is submitted. Does a mass tort case always end up in court?

Most of mass tort claims conclude through negotiated agreements. That said, preparing as if a trial is inevitable tends to result in better compensation. If your case does proceed to trial, your mass tort lawyer will be fully prepared to argue on your behalf.

What injuries are typically covered in mass tort cases?

Qualifying injuries often involve cancer diagnoses linked to chemical exposure, organ damage from pharmaceutical side effects, and long-term disability from dangerous consumer products. A mass tort lawyer reviews your specific medical history to determine whether your injuries match documented cases from the same product or substance.

Do I need to join a class action to pursue mass tort compensation?

These are two separate legal structures. Under a class action structure, the full group share a single outcome. With individual tort claims, every victim keeps a separate, individual claim built around the unique facts of your situation. The mass tort framework is typically more advantageous for victims with serious, documented injuries.
